Your new role As an SEN Teaching Assistant or 1:1 Support Assistant, you'll play a vital role in supporting pupils with a range of additional needs, helping them to thrive both academically and socially.

Responsibilities may include: Providing 1:1 support for pupils with SEN Supporting children with Autism (ASD), ADHD, speech and language needs, and other additional learning needs Implementing strategies to support behaviour and engagement Encouraging independence, confidence and social development Working closely with class teachers, SENCOs and other professionals Creating a safe, nurturing and inclusive learning environment Roles are available on both a full-time and part-time basis, with long-term opportunities throughout the academic year.
